Fill a drinking glass with water and stick a few ice cubes in it while you grate the frozen butter.
-
2
Place butter in the freezer until youre ready to use it.
-
3
Whisk together the flour and salt in a medium-sized bowl.
-
4
Take the ice water and measure out 1/4 cup into a 1-cup measuring cup.
-
5
Crack the egg into the measured ice water and beat with a fork.
-
6
Grab the grated butter from the freezer and dump it into the dry ingredients.
-
7
Using your fingers, break up the butter if it clumps together to thoroughly combine everything.
-
8
Pour in the egg-water mixture and stir with a hefty spoon.
-
9
Add a tablespoon or two of water if it seems dry.
-
10
Gather all the dough into one lump.
-
11
Divide it in half.
-
12
If youre not using both crusts, wrap one half in plastic wrap, place it in a freezer bag and freeze it.
-
13
Or put it in the fridge if you plan on using it within a couple of days.
-
14
Using a wet washrag or your wet hands, moisten the countertop and place a piece of wax paper over top.
-
15
It shouldnt slide anywhere.
-
16
Sprinkle flour over the wax paper and place your dough ball in the center, flattening it like a disk.
-
17
Start rolling it out, working from the center to the outsides.
-
18
Turn your pie plate upside down on the dough and cut the dough with a sharp knife about an inch larger than the pie plate.
-
19
Remove the dough from the wax paper by rolling the dough up onto the rolling pin while peeling away the paper underneath.
-
20
Gently lift the dough up and over to the pie plate, centering it as you unroll it from the rolling pin.
-
21
Press the dough into the pie plate, but dont stretch it.
-
22
(Itll shrink when it bakes.)
-
23
Fold the ragged edges of the pie crust under the side of the plate.
-
24
If you want, you can flute the edges.
-
25
If youre making an apple pie or something where the crust isnt pre-baked, its ready to use.
-
26
If youre baking the crust by itself, preheat the oven to 375 degrees F and poke a lot of holes in the bottom of the crust with a fork to keep it from bubbling up.
-
27
Bake for 10-12 minutes or until the edges just barely start to turn brown.
-
28
(Dont let the raw dough sit out for too long before you bake it.
-
29
Stick it in the fridge if you need to wait for the oven to heat up.)
-
30
Makes TWO pie crusts.
